We are looking for an amazing communications and content officer to bring to life our ambition of more space for nature, with more people on nature’s side by telling stories, running campaigns and mobilising communities to reach our goal of 1 in 4 people acting for nature.
This post will help the marketing and communications team to develop a bold and confident voice to increase our impact and influence, alongside changing our language to be more accessible, engaging and inclusive for a wide range of audiences.
Overview
As well as creating amazing content and project managing the Wild Warwickshire membership magazine, you will also build relationships with journalists, deal with media enquiries and seek out PR opportunities to promote the Trust. You will work across all Trust departments to find our stories and use these to showcase our work, alongside working externally with others who are making space for nature and acting for wildlife, using these stories to inspire action from our audiences.
If you are an experienced communicator with a passion to use your skills to help us to tackle the environmental crises by inspiring local action, then we’d love to hear from you.
